1. Reliability Philosophy
Owners and EPCs do not buy a “hook” or a “system” - they buy certainty: predictable performance, verifiable safety margins, and controllable lifecycle cost. GLEN builds that certainty through an engineering-led reliability framework.
What we commit to in every project:
Engineering-first design: design calculations, fatigue considerations, and interface alignment are treated as contract deliverables, not internal notes.
Evidence-based compliance: each key requirement is linked to a measurable test, record, or certificate (traceable proof).
Controlled manufacturing: gated inspections from raw material to final function test - no “black box” steps.
Lifecycle readiness: commissioning, training, spares strategy and serviceability are planned upfront to avoid future downtime.
Transparency & accountability: operational data, event records and maintenance history support clear responsibility and continuous improvement.
2. Quality Management & Governance
GLEN operates a structured Quality Management System aligned with international best practices (e.g., ISO 9001 principles) and integrates class / third-party verification when required by the project.
Project Quality Plan (PQP) - PLAN: Requirement-to-Evidence Map
For each contract, GLEN issues a Project Quality Plan (PQP) as the project’s control blueprint. It translates the specification into a clear map of responsibilities, acceptance criteria, and deliverables so Engineering, Procurement, Production and Inspection stay aligned from day one.
